Coconut Oil Popcorn

Coconut Oil Popcorn

An easy, delicious stove top popcorn popped with coconut oil.

Course Snack
Cuisine American
Keyword Popcorn
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 8 minutes
Total Time 13 minutes
Servings 3 quarts
Author Heather @ thecookstreat.com

Ingredients

  • ½ cup popcorn kernels
  • cup coconut oil
  • 1 scant teaspoon Real or Himalayan salt

Instructions

  1. Place a large, heavy bottom pan (at least 5 quart) with a good tight fitting over medium high heat. Place 1/3 cup coconut oil in pan along with 2 popcorn kernels. Replace the lid and wait for both kernels to pop (on my stove this takes about 6 minutes).
  2. Meanwhile combine ½ cup popcorn kernels and 1 scant teaspoon salt. When both kernels have popped, add this popcorn/salt mixture to the pan. Carefully replace the lid and shake the pan a couple of times to redistribute the kernels evenly on the bottom of the pan.
  3. As the popcorn kernels are popping lift the pan off the stove and shake a few more times. The popping should last less than 2 minutes (See note).
  4. When popping has slowed considerably, carefully remove the pan from the burner and set it to the side, but don’t remove the lid yet.
  5. Finally when the popping has stopping completely, remove the lid and stir the popcorn to mix it well and dig in.

Recipe Notes

1. If the popping lasts longer or shorter than the time frame I suggest in the directions, you probably don’t have the heat adjusted quite right. You don’t want it so high that the kernels burn, but you want it high enough that they have enough heat to pop. Experiment to see what that heat is for your stove, but for my electric stove the dial is set to about a 7.
